As an APAC Branches Operations Project and Governance Lead – Vice President within Digital and Platform Services, you lead governance initiatives and strategic projects across branch operations. You partner with stakeholders to assess risks, engineer effective solutions, and execute projects that improve risk profile and efficiency. You champion a culture of continuous improvement, using data, analytics, and digital tools to inform decisions and deliver measurable enhancements. Together, we ensure compliant, well-controlled processes that support clients and market integrity. You will be part of a team that applies deep operational expertise and data-driven insights to strengthen processes end to end.
The APAC Branch Operations Projects and Governance team oversees the successful delivery of multiple cross-branch location projects. You will formulate strategic projects that achieve efficient operations processing and consistent approaches across nine locations within the APAC Branch organization. You will work closely with the Branch Operations manager and the Digital and Platform Services Change team to deliver results and drive operational excellence.
Job responsibilities
- Manage a cross-branch, multi-year operations project and governance team
- Collaborate with program leads and operations teams to understand challenges and design technical solutions using innovative tools and artificial intelligence models
- Execute and deliver efficiency savings through successful project implementation, overseeing return on investment tracking and ensuring project outcomes meet strategic and financial objectives
- Lead a team, providing guidance and ensuring high-quality delivery
- Design effective solutions by quickly understanding complex market products, operational processes, and regulatory requirements
- Ensure all innovation use cases adhere to regulatory requirements, technology lifecycle development, and governance standards, maintaining a strong control mindset
- Provide independent challenge and articulate risk, issues, and impact-weighted solutions to stakeholders
- Drive implementation of process improvement automations and strategic initiatives to enhance operational effectiveness and risk reduction
- Champion the use of data analytics and digital tools to monitor performance and inform decisions
- Prepare and deliver concise updates for senior management and external stakeholders
- Foster a culture of innovation, continuous improvement, and accountability across operations
Required qualifications, capabilities, and skills
- Bachelor’s degree
- Minimum ten years of experience in financial services with a background in operations, project management, operations controls, consulting, or operational risk management
- Demonstrated project management capabilities, including leading large-scale transformation or enterprise-wide change management projects, managing multiple initiatives, and providing timely updates through completion.
- Proven leadership skills with experience developing high-performance teams
- Ability to analyze, question, and challenge end-to-end operations processes and recommend enhanced control methods
- Excellent problem-solving, verbal, and written communication skills with the ability to influence at all levels, including senior executives and external partners
- Exceptional attention to detail, strong organization, and the ability to manage multiple priorities in a high-pressure environment
- Result-driven mentality amidst time pressure
Preferred qualifications, capabilities, and skills
- Strong knowledge of market products and understanding of front-to-back operations processes
- Advanced proficiency in data analytics and automation tools, including Alteryx, Tableau, Python, Visual Basic for Applications, and Structured Query Language
